How often should bear spray be replaced?

Bear spray should be replaced every two years, or sooner if it has been used. Inspect the canister for any damage, such as dents or cracks, and make sure the nozzle is not clogged. The bear spray should be stored in a cool, dry place away from sunlight.

Is police pepper spray stronger?

In general, yes, police pepper spray is stronger than the pepper spray that is available to the general public. The main difference is in the concentration of the active ingredient, oleoresin capsicum (OC). Police pepper spray typically has a concentration of 10% OC, while civilian pepper spray generally has a concentration of between 1% and 5% OC. In addition, police pepper spray is usually formulated to be more effective in disabling an assailant than civilian pepper spray.

Can bear spray be kept in a car?

Yes, bear spray can be kept in a car, but there are a few things to keep in mind. First, bear spray should be kept in a cool, dry place. If it gets too hot, the canister may explode. Second, bear spray should be kept out of reach of children and pets. Finally, bear spray should be replaced every few years to ensure it is effective.
